Federman & Sherwood Investigates Blink Charging Co. for Possible Violations of Federal Securities Laws

Oklahoma City, OK (August 16, 2018) – The law firm of Federman & Sherwood has initiated an investigation into Blink Charging Co. (“Blink”) and its officers and directors, with respect to possible violations of federal securities laws.

Blink Charging Co. is one of the leaders in nationwide public electric vehicle (EV) charging equipment and services, enabling EV drivers to easily charge at locations throughout the United States.  Headquartered in Florida with offices in Arizona and California, Blink’s business is designed to accelerate EV adoption.  Federman & Sherwood is investigating possible breaches of fiduciary duty.
